The Ginnanho-Yari has an unusual shape.
The Ginnanho-Yari is not intended for stabbing, but rather for striking through armor to inflict impact. Therefore, its tip is deliberately made blunt rather than sharp.
Signature : Monju Kaneshige saku
Nagasa : 91mm (3.58 in.)
Sori : 0mm (0.0 in.)
Total length : 660mm (25.98 in.)
Motohaba : 18.8mm (0.74 in.)
Sakihaba : 20.3mm (0.80 in.)
Motokasane : 9.8mm (0.39 in.)
Sakikasane : 7.5mm (0.30 in.)
Blade Weight : 103g
Total Weight : 284g
